Getting Started: Registration and Verification

The first hurdle is creating an account. Most ETH‑based casinos keep the sign‑up form short: email address, a password and a choice of currency (select “Ethereum” if you plan to use ETH). After you confirm the email, you’ll be asked for a few identity documents – a photo ID, proof of address and sometimes a selfie for KYC (Know Your Customer) compliance.

Verification usually finishes within a few hours, but it can stretch to 24 hours during peak traffic. While you wait, you can explore the demo versions of slots and live tables; these are fully functional but don’t require any deposit. When the account is approved, you’ll see a dedicated Ethereum wallet address generated just for you – copy that address carefully for the next step.

Depositing with Ethereum – Payment Methods and Fees

Funding your casino balance with ETH is straightforward. Open your personal wallet (MetaMask, Trust Wallet or a hardware device) and send the desired amount to the casino‑provided address. The transaction is confirmed by the network, typically in under a minute for standard gas fees.

Some platforms also accept popular fiat‑to‑crypto bridges, letting you buy ETH directly on the site with iDEAL or credit card. These services add a small markup, usually 1–2 % of the amount, but they spare you the hassle of moving coins between wallets. Keep an eye on the “minimum deposit” field – most ETH casinos set it around 0.01 ETH, which is roughly €15 at current rates.

Bonuses and Wagering Requirements – What to Look For

Welcome bonuses are the most visible incentive, but they come with strings attached. A typical ETH casino will offer a 100 % match up to 0.5 ETH plus a handful of free spins. The catch: you must wager the bonus amount 30–40 times before you can withdraw any winnings.

Read the fine print for “eligible games.” Slots usually count 100 % towards the wagering, while live casino tables may count only 10 %. If you prefer low‑volatility slots, a bonus with a modest wagering requirement is a better fit than one that forces you onto high‑risk games.

Another useful perk is a “no‑deposit bonus.” Some ETH casinos hand out a small amount of ETH (e.g., 0.001 ETH) just for signing up – perfect for testing the waters without risking your own funds. Always check the expiration date; these offers typically disappear after 7 days.

Withdrawals: Speed, Limits and Security

Cash‑out requests at a casino with ETH are generally the fastest part of the process. Once you submit a withdrawal, the casino creates a transaction to your personal wallet address. Most sites process these within 10–30 minutes, provided your account has passed full KYC verification.

Withdrawal limits vary: some platforms cap daily payouts at 5 ETH, while others allow up to 20 ETH per week for premium members. Fees are usually minimal – often just the network gas price, which can be as low as €0.10 during low‑traffic periods.

Security measures include two‑factor authentication (2FA) on both the casino and your personal wallet, as well as encryption of all personal data. If you ever suspect an issue, reputable support teams will freeze the transaction and investigate within an hour.
